MQM was involved in schools attack, reveals held worker

KARACHI: The terror suspect, Amir ‘Sarpata, who was reportedly arrested during the Rangers raid on Nine-Zero, revealed during his interrogation that the MQM was involved in an attack on a school, local media quoting sources reported on Friday.
According to the suspect, a meeting, presided over by senior MQM leaders Haider Abbas Rizvi and Kunwar Naveed, was held in which they issued directions for terrorising school owners. During the meeting, orders were issued to attack a school with crackers and also issue threatening pamphlets.
Amir also revealed that the real intent behind the cracker attack was to divert the operation towards outlawed and banned organizations in Karachi. He revealed that the directives to carry out the attack were issued in January this year.
According to sources, after Amir made such startling disclosures against the top MQM leader, Rangers personnel grilled MQM’s Haider Abbas Rizvi and asked him that he could not leave the city until investigations of these allegations were completed.MQM’s representatives Wasay Jalil and Ali Raza Abidi were quick to respond to the latest allegations against their party and its leader Haider Abbas Rizvi .
